Senator Helen Drayton’s first fictional novel, The Crystal Bird, is a must-read according to the reviews from several readers of the novel. This is her third book. She has previously written two books of poems titled Brown Doves Passages I and II.

Kelli Richards was born and bred in Cupertino, Silicon Valley. It’s where Apple’s headquarters is based and where she spent ten years as an executive. At the age of eight, she knew she wanted to become a record producer.
